Civil Designer User Group Workshops |
|
| |
|
The first set of user group sessions kicked off in East London on 17 May 2007. The user group meetings have been designed in order to provide clients with an opportunity to receive interactive workshops presented by the Knowledge Base software developers within their fields of expertise.
|
Arcus Gibb and Africon were among the first to receive presentations covering Sewer House Connections in the Sewer module as well as the latest SWMM methodology in the Stormwater module. The sessions delivered by Stormwater Developer Johan Swart and National Key Accounts Manager Reece Hanning also provided a sneak preview on new functionality in the upcoming 6.5 version.
Other user group meetings conducted in the Mpumalanga region on 23 - 24 May included presentations at Endecon, Tumber Fourie, Mbombela Local Municipality, and the Department of Agriculture. During these sessions the Roads Developer Dawid du Toit focused on Quantities and Templates in the current Civil Designer version and also reviewed some of the new functionality in the upcoming version. AUXILLARY LANES
 |
The upcoming Civil Designer 6.5 version allows the addition of Auxillary Lanes in the Roads Module
via a simple dialogue, facilitating the creation of climbing lanes, drop off areas, bus embankments and
other lanes. The function allows you to specify the left or right alignment, the width,
the start and end
|
chainage position, the taper lead-in and lead-out length and the layer works template
to be applied before the auxillary lane is automatically created.
The Auxillary Lanes Function also includes a 'Speed Profiles' tool which calculates the point on an ascent at which a climbing lane should be positioned.
